Six individuals and one band of brothers were honored with 2022 Horticultural Industries Leadership Awards at a reception July 17 at Cultivate'22 in Columbus, Ohio. Editorial director Kelli Rodda and editor Matt McClellan detailed the achievements of each winner, and then presented them with their award.
The Horticultural Industries Leadership Awards (HILA), sponsored by Syngenta, is the only national awards program to honor leaders from the greenhouse and nursery industries.
